TV Menu
When you first turned on your HDTV you set up your TV for DTV / TV channels using the Initial Setup
screens. If you did not do this or if your setup has changed, you can do this from your HDTV
menu.
1. Press MENU on the remote control and the Picture menu will be shown on the screen.

Tuner Mode
Select Cable or Antenna depending upon which
equipment you have attached to the DTV / TV Input.
Auto Search
Automatically search for TV channels that are
available in your area. Your HDTV will search for
analog and digital channels.
Partial Channel Search
If you believe channels were missed from the auto
search, you can do a partial channel search to look
for channel in a certain channel range again. Select
to scan for Analog, Digital, or both Analog/Digital

MTS
This feature allows you to select the different languages the broadcaster is transmitting the audio with the
program you are watching. This language is usually Spanish.
Time Zone
Setting the correct Time Zone for your area will ensure that the correct program times are shown after
pressing INFO on the remote control.
Daylight Saving
Setting the daylight saving time for your area will ensure that the correct program times are shown after
pressing INFO on the remote control.
